Purpose and Setting of Bail 

Bail is not per se a payment for the person not to suffer the penalty as its primary purpose is serving as an option for the defendant to temporarily stay out of jail after the arrest. It can be in the form of cash, property or bond that is given to the court for the assurance of having the presence of person during the trial upon formal order. If in case the accused fails to attend during the hearing, the court will keep the bail and issue warrant of arrest to detain him/her. Meanwhile, the judges have the responsibility of setting bail based on the schedules set forth to serve this purpose. But if the defendant cannot afford the amount required, the recourse is asking the judge through top criminal lawyers to lower such during the bail setting hearing or first appearance in court.
